1991 Jaguar XJ6 vs. 2013 Audi A5

To start off, 2013 Audi A5 is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1991 Jaguar XJ6.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1991 Jaguar XJ6 would be higher. At 3,980 cc (6 cylinders), 1991 Jaguar XJ6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1991 Jaguar XJ6 (224 HP) has 16 more horse power than 2013 Audi A5. (208 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1991 Jaguar XJ6 should accelerate faster than 2013 Audi A5.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1991 Jaguar XJ6 weights approximately 260 kg more than 2013 Audi A5.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1991 Jaguar XJ6 (377 Nm) has 27 more torque (in Nm) than 2013 Audi A5. (350 Nm). This means 1991 Jaguar XJ6 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2013 Audi A5.
